Output 95c77b00806c88d4bcd53114bdbd8c54e7b08488a93f346311c21ca80e07ccf6:0

value
323557
script pubkey
OP_0 OP_PUSHBYTES_20 59d3751c995d418860517fb47026141ec57a66c0
address
bc1qt8fh28yet4qcscz30768qfs5rmzh5ekqkqump7
transaction
95c77b00806c88d4bcd53114bdbd8c54e7b08488a93f346311c21ca80e07ccf6
spent
true